The Moto Z Force Droid Edition is slightly better than Huawei Mate 10 Lite, getting a 76.4 score against 74.2. Moto Z Force Droid Edition's design is just a bit thinner and just a little bit lighter than the Huawei Mate 10 Lite, despite of the fact that it was released just 15 months before. Huawei Mate 10 Lite counts with a bit more powerful processing unit than Moto Z Force Droid Edition, and although they both have the same RAM amount, the Huawei Mate 10 Lite also has more processing cores.
Motorola Moto Z Force Droid Edition features a little more vivid display than Huawei Mate 10 Lite, because although it has a little bit smaller display, it also counts with a better pixel amount in each inch of display and a better resolution of 1440 x 2560 pixels. The Moto Z Force Droid Edition counts with much more storage to store more apps and games than Huawei Mate 10 Lite, and although they both have the same 64 GB internal memory capacity, the Moto Z Force Droid Edition also has a SD card slot that allows up to 1,95 TB.
The Moto Z Force Droid Edition captures just a bit better videos and photos than Huawei Mate 10 Lite, because it has a larger diafragm aperture for better low light photos and videos, a much higher 3840x2160 (4K) video definition and a much better 21 mega-pixels resolution back-facing camera. The Motorola Moto Z Force Droid Edition counts with just a bit longer battery lifetime than Huawei Mate 10 Lite, because it has 3500mAh of battery capacity.
